Certification Regarding Eligibility
To Apply for Worker Adjustment Assistance

In accordance with Section 223 of the Trade Act of 1974, as
amended (19 USC 2273), the Department of Labor herein presents the
results of an investigation regarding certification of eligibility
to apply for worker adjustment assistance.
In order to make an affirmative determination and issue a
certification of eligibility to apply for Trade Adjustment
Assistance, the group eligibility requirements in either paragraph
(a)(2)(A) or (a)(2)(B) of Section 222 of the Trade Act must be met.
It is determined in this case that the requirements of (a)(2)(B) of
Section 222 have been met.
The investigation was initiated on July 10, 2003 in response
to a petition filed by the company on behalf of workers at Dana
Corporation, Hose & Tubing Products Division, Crenshaw,
Mississippi. The workers at the subject facility produce rubber
hoses.
The investigation revealed that Dana Corp. leased production
workers from Manpower to produce rubber hoses.
The preponderance in the declines in employment at the subject
facility is related to a shift in facility production of rubber
hoses to a country (Mexico) that is a party to a free trade
agreement with the United States.
Conclusion
After careful review of the facts obtained in the
investigation, I conclude that there was a shift in production from
the workers' firm or subdivision to Mexico of articles that are
like or directly competitive with those produced by the subject
firm or subdivision.
In accordance with the provisions of the Act, I make the
following certification:
"All workers of Dana Corporation, Hose & Tubing Products
Division, Crenshaw, Mississippi, and leased workers of
Manpower producing rubber hoses at Dana Corporation, Hose &
Tubing Products Division, Crenshaw, Mississippi, who became
totally or partially separated from employment on or after
June 25, 2002, through two years from the date of
certification, are eligible to apply for adjustment assistance
under Section 223 of the Trade Act of 1974."
